Grading recycle device for electric flocculation and electric floatation purification bathing and washing wastewater

The invention discloses a grading recycle device for electric flocculation and electric floatation purification bathing and washing wastewater, which is characterized in that one part of effluent from a wastewater collecting tank, passing through a tee joint, is used as front end effluent to be directly output, and the other path is serially connected with a Venturi tube, the wastewater outlet of the Venturi tube is connected with an electrolytic bath, the throat tube of the Venturi tube is communicated with an air inlet tube with a filter casing; the electrolytic bath is set to be an iron promoted dual-anodic oxidization unit which has a structure that a Tl/SnO2 anode and an Fe anode are respectively arranged at two sides of a cathode to form a combined anode, and the cathode adopts an air diffusion electrode; the wastewater outlet of the electrolytic bath is serially provided with a two-stage filtering unit, a primary filtering chamber of the two-stage filtering unit is provided with a primary wastewater outlet valve, and a secondary filtering chamber of the two-stage filtering unit is provided with a secondary wastewater outlet valve. The invention can effectively reduce or remove surface activating agents and other organic pollutants in washing/bathing wastewater to ensure that the bath/washing wastewater is recycled by stages.

Upper air inlet gas cookware

The invention discloses upper air inlet gas cookware, belongs to gas cookware and solves the problems of inadequate combustion, low efficiency and small power caused by poor ejection capacity of the conventional gas cookware. In the upper air inlet gas cookware, a burner base is provided with a central ejector pipe and is connected with two side ejector pipes, an annular groove is formed on the upper surface of the burner base, an air admission hole is formed on one side face of the burner base and legs are arranged at the bottom of the burner base; a circular path is formed on the lower end face of an outer ring fire cover, fire holes are formed on the outer circumference of the outer ring fire cover and a central fire cover is arranged in the center of the outer ring fire cover; and a central gas nozzle and a central gas interface are arranged at the bottom of the gas ejection base and two spray pipes aligned with two side ejector pipe inlets respectively are arranged on the upper surface of the gas ejection base. The upper air inlet gas cookware improves gas inlet capacity, mixes gas uniformly, has adequate combustion and increases power; and foreign matters cannot enter a shell, so that the health of consumers is facilitated. By the upper air inlet gas cookware, the heat absorption efficiency of a pot can reach 55 percent; the emissions of CO and NOx is lower than 400ppm and 300ppm respectively which are far below the national energy-saving environmental protection index.

Mould-proof and moth-proof treatment method for poplar

The invention mainly relates to the field of wood treatment, and discloses a mould-proof and moth-proof treatment method for poplar. The method includes the steps of heating steaming, freeze drying, soaking for sterilization and heating curing. The method is simple, no harmful chemical components are contained, the bacteriostasis rate of the poplar is made to reach 76.3%, storage and usage are facilitated, the service life is prolonged by 16.2%, losses caused by mildew and damage by worms are reduced, and the economic income is increased by 7.6%. The poplar is placed into steam for steaming, a flash high temperature is obtained to kill infectious microbes inside the poplar and on the surface of the poplar, and the phenomenon of mildew and damage by worms can be restrained; and meanwhile, the temperature is lowered gradually after the flash high temperature, the filter structure can be loosened, softness of the poplar is improved, and the cracking phenomenon is reduced. The poplar is subjected to freeze drying, the dense air pore structure inside the poplar is added, the air content is increased, moisture missing is facilitated, and mould growth is inhibited; and meanwhile, due to the dense air pore structure, the deformation degree of the poplar can be raised, the softness is improved, the brittleness is lowered, and cracking and deformation are reduced.

Method and device for reducing wave-making resistance and friction force during ship navigation

The invention discloses a method and device for reducing wave-making resistance and friction force during ship navigation. The device comprises a gas-liquid mixing device and a control device which are connected, wherein the gas-liquid mixing device is provided with a water inlet, a gas inlet, a water outlet and the gas-liquid mixing cavity arranged between the water inlet and the water outlet; water and gas respectively enter the gas-liquid mixing cavity through the water inlet and the gas inlet; the control device controls air intake of the gas inlet; in the process, the water inlet is controlled to intermittently pause water feeding or intermittently feed water at a low speed or feed water at a low speed all the time; therefore, more gas can enter the gas-liquid mixing cavity; the gas-liquid mixing device can generate a gas-water mixture containing a large number of bubbles; the gas-water mixture is injected into a water area at the front end of a ship or / and on the two sides of theship, so that the water density of the water area can be greatly reduced, the sailing speed of the ship and the maneuverability of the ship can be greatly improved, or the fuel consumption is greatlyreduced at the same sailing speed, and the performance of the ship is greatly improved.

Guide wire horn nozzle of filter stick forming machine

The invention relates to a guide wire horn nozzle of a filter stick forming machine. The guide wire horn nozzle is in a horn tube shape, inwards projected convex edges are arranged on the inner wall of the horn nozzle, inclined contact surfaces are processed on the front ends of the convex edges, air inlet holes are arranged on the side wall of one end of the horn nozzle near a wire outlet, an outer sleeve is fixedly arranged outside the air inlet holes, air grooves are formed between the outer sleeve and the side wall of the horn nozzle, air inlets are fixedly arranged on the outer sleeve, a heating seat is also arranged on the side surface of the outer sleeve, and a heating wire is arranged in the heating seat. When the technical scheme is adopted, under the effects of three techniques of the convex edges, the heater and the air inlet holes, wire bundles inside the filter nozzle sticks are extruded and formed out of the grooves, a wire bundle dense region and a wire bundle loose region are formed, when filter tip sticks are assembled onto cigarettes to be used, air permeating from connecting and mounting paper and forming paper can easily enter the deep part of the filter tip sticks along the wire bundle loose region, the air intake quantity is increased, and in addition, the mixing uniformity of the air and the smoke gas can also be increased. Therefore, the tar content in the smoke gas can also be reduced.

Preparation method for super-amphiphobic surface of iron group metal

The invention provides a preparation method for a super-amphiphobic surface of iron group metal. The preparation method comprises the following steps of firstly, carrying out pretreatment on the surface of the iron group metal or an alloy substrate of the iron group metal; secondly, carrying out hydroxylation treatment on the surface of the substrate treated in the first step; and thirdly, soakingthe substrate treated in the second step into a solution containing fluoroalkyl silane for surface chemical modification of organic film, and completing the preparation process by forming the super-amphiphobic film on the surface of the iron group metal or the alloy substrate of the iron group metal. According to the preparation method for the super-amphiphobic surface of the iron group metal, the iron group metal or the alloy of the iron group metal is used as the substrate, and a structure with a special roughness is formed on the iron group metal or the alloy of the iron group metal, in other words, first-grade roughness is provided; and the surface can be quickly modified with fluoroalkyl silane after surface hydroxylation is carried out, so that surface energy is reduced, and roughness may be further improved to form the super-amphiphobic surface. The preparation method for the super-amphiphobic surface of the iron group metal is simple in preparation technology, good in bindingforce between the substrate and the organic film, and capable of being widely used for corrosion prevention, stain prevention, adhesion prevention, self cleaning and the like of all types of metal.

Method for controlling rotating speed of stirring motor of ice cream machine based on temperature and forming degree

The invention discloses a method for controlling the rotating speed of a stirring motor of an ice cream machine based on temperature and forming degree, the ice cream machine further comprises a control system, the control system comprises a main controller, a temperature monitoring module and a frequency converter, and the frequency converter is connected with the stirring motor and used for adjusting the input frequency of the stirring motor. The temperature monitoring module is used for monitoring the temperature of the ice cream material in the evaporation cylinder or the air return temperature value of the evaporation cylinder and transmitting the temperature monitoring value to the main controller, and the frequency converter obtains the real-time working torque value of the stirring motor and transmitts the monitored working torque value to the main controller so as to obtain the real-time forming degree proportion value of the ice cream in the evaporation cylinder, and the main controller adjusts the output power frequency of the frequency converter according to any one or the combination of the temperature monitoring value and the real-time forming degree proportion value and the rotating speed of the stirring motor is further adjusted. The energy consumption and noise of the ice cream machine can be reduced.
